Attachment Theory

FULL-LENGTH PLAY: Amidst a fierce blizzard, a family confronts their grief after a sudden loss. As the snowstorm rages outside, inner turmoil unfolds within as buried secrets, fears, and revelations about the past challenge their understanding of each other, forcing them to question love, loyalty, and what it truly means to know and trust those closest to us.

  • Morey Norkin: Attachment Theory

    Darrin Friedman writes smart ensemble pieces that get to the heart of relationships and the secrets that shape and potentially break them. ATTACHMENT THEORY is a master class. The structure, with brief lectures on attachment theory introducing scenes, sheds light on what makes these characters tick, but the choices they make are not predictable. Four unique, strong female characters that you won’t soon forget. I have a feeling we’ll be hearing a lot about this play.

  • Kim E. Ruyle: Attachment Theory

    Friedman has theatrically animated a psychological framework in this woman-centered play so that, rather than being academic and clinical, Attachment Theory is an engaging story. The premise is a great starting point, but it’s the distinctly drawn principal characters that give this play vitality. Jackie and Jasmine are especially compelling characters and breathe life and humor and insight into the story, but the ensemble works so well together and gives Attachment Theory a beating heart.
